Ignatan (ig-nah-TAHN)

The magic of fire and ice

Ignatan is the technical term for those who possess the ability to control the temperature of matter. It is an Elemental form of magic. The term 'Ignatan' is generally only used in The Stiriphese. The rest of Favont knows those with this power as fire demons.

 

Field Notes

 

The Department of Standards originally asked me to look into different 'demon' types, which like anyone from Favont, I understood to mean different types of Ananan magic. Only when I arrived in Steffen, and asked to be introduced to a fire demon, did I first hear this term 'Ignatan' which was said with a great rolling of many eyes and disappointment that I did not know its proper name.

 
Meridian Faro

I was introduced to Corporal Meridian Faro, an Ananan, and Ignatan serving in the Nightguard. He was polite, very respectful, and had great command over his powers. I asked him to display the full range, which he did, without flourish or hesitation.

 

I gave my report to the D.O.S who rejected it due to the name being part of the Ananan language and that they did not consider it appropriate to use. They did, however, accept 'fire demon.'

 

For my own journal, I will continue to use the proper term.

 

Manifestation

 

We are taught that Ananans chant incantations to create magic, drawing on the dark forces from The Pit. I saw no evidence of this. We are also taught that Ananans stole their magic, but I also fail to see how that can be possible. Their skills are so impressive, that if to achieve them all you had to do was commit theft, there would be more Ananans!

 

Corporal Faro explained that the powers of Ignatan are a spectrum, ranging from the very hot, to the very cold.

 
Fit to work
 

All elementals, regardless of type, must be healthy to use their powers. Those who are sick can not access them, and many elementals only realise that they are sick when they see their magic fade. As soon as health is restored, the magic returns.

Hot

 

He began with fire, first with his hands, showing me how his skin took the appearance of coal beneath the flickering flames. He opened his mouth and breathed out fire, akin to a dragon. Finally, he changed his whole body, clothes and all, into flaming coal. When he changed back, it was as if he had never been on fire in the first place.

 

Faro explained that he can change more matter than just himself into fire. He can change anything he touches, from his clothes to the floor, and even to me, if he were to touch me before changing.

 

Fire, however, is his most extreme manifestation. He can also heat things simply by touching them. He demonstrated this with a cup of tea, placing a finger in the liquid until it boiled before my eyes. Apparently, he could have boiled the tea just by holding the cup, but he did not want to risk cracking the china.

 

He invited me to hold his hand. It was very hot to begin with, any hotter and I might have burnt myself. As I touched his skin, I felt him rapidly cool to a normal body temperature, and then beyond, until his skin felt clammy, and then colder than death.

 
Can change anything into fire, or simply warm it
 

Cold

 

Ice crystals began to form across his skin. Apparently, he can move from fire to ice in seconds, but for me, so that I could witness the full spectrum, he slowed the transition.

His skin became whiter and gradually more translucent. He touched the tea, and this time it froze over, sliding perfectly inside the cup. His clothes also lightened, first covered in frost, then turning translucent themselves, until he took on the appearance of a carved ice sculpture.

Refracted light filled the room. I could hear the creak and grind as the ice crystals of his body scoured against one another. He retained his full range of movement, but it was surprisingly noisy.

Then it seemed disaster had struck. Where Meridian Faro had once stood, there was now only a pile of ice crystals. I was horrified, convinced I had pushed him too far and that he had shattered under his own magic. The crystals wobbled and glittered, then rolled towards one another, and he rose up from them, chuckling at my distress.

The colour of his skin and clothes returned, and not a single trace of ice or frost remained in the room.

Uses

 

I was surprised to learn that although Faro is in the army, he has very little cause to use his magic directly in his work.

He is professionally trained to use fire and ice in self-defence, but only as a diversion or deterrent. “Death is neither imminent nor guaranteed,” as he put it. That was a very surreal conversation.

When I asked about uses away from the army, he admitted that, like most Ignatans, he uses it for small, everyday tasks. These are so embedded in his life that he barely considers them to be “magic”.

He listed the following, though he added there are probably more that he simply had not considered:

 
  • Creating fires
  • cooking or freezing food
  • as a lighter/ light
  • Keeping warm/ keeping cool
  • Relieving muscle tightness
  • Melting or creating snow or ice
  • Creating steam
  • Ironing clothes
 

As an Ignatan, he impervious to extreme temperatures, and can survive very comfortably in those environments. His internal body temperature always remains regulated, unless he becomes sick, then it goes 'haywire' and he jumps from fever to chill.

Training

 

When I asked how he developed his skill in using magic, he explained it simply.

 

There's no books, or courses, or qualifications. Instead your family, your school, and your community, teach you how to be decent, and to use you skills with decency.

 

I took this moment to ask about Terva and their arson attacks, and whether those involved had training to commit that crime, or knew their actions were wrong.

 

You don't have to be an Ignatan or even an Ananan to be an arsonist. Some people will always act selfishly and cause others injury.

Final Notes

 

Perhaps out of all the 'demon' types, Ignatan are the most visually terrifying. Their entire bodies can change into two states that we know, as pervious mortals, are both dangerous.

 

I asked him if other Ananans felt as scared of his kind as we did, to which Corporal Faro laughed, and that among Ananans, the Ignatans are referred to as cooks.
